Article: DUPAGE TWP. RAISES RENTAL RATES AT LEVY CENTER BANQUET HALL

DuPage Township Supervisor Bob Schanks' proposal to raise the rental fee of the Levy Center Banquet facility was approved by the board of trustees at their Tuesday night meeting. The measure was approved much to the chagrin of some of the trustees.

The measure will raise the current rate for private rentals from $300 for five hours to $100 per hour and $100 for each hour past midnight,

"I am trying to put us into a position where we can make a profit," Schanks told the board.

"As the rates are now, we are giving the thing away."

Trustee Lin Schroth was not the least bit pleased with Schanks' proposal.

"To charge people by the hour bothers me," Schroth said.
